Azerbaijani Parliament Condemns Biased Resolution Of European Parliament


(MENAFN- Trend News Agency) BAKU, Azerbaijan, April 25. The Milli Majlis(Parliament) of Azerbaijan regards the European Parliament'sresolution on civil society and human rights in Azerbaijan, passedon April 25, 2024, as a biased political move lacking objectivity,and vehemently refutes groundless charges based on inaccurate andmanipulated facts, Trend reports, referring to the statement ofthe Parliament regarding the resolution.

It was stated that it is unfortunate that this institution hasbecome a weapon for entities engaged in a hostile and slanderouscampaign against Azerbaijan following the Second Karabakh War,which ended Armenia's 30-year control of Azerbaijani territory.

"Since 2021, the European Parliament has passed eightresolutions against Azerbaijan under various pretexts. At a timewhen efforts are ongoing to advance the normalization processfollowing the Armenia-Azerbaijan conflict, including preliminaryprogress in boundary delimitation, the European Parliament's recentaction seeks to degrade Azerbaijan's reputation and derail thepeace process. These acts are driven by forces with a dogmaticmindset, unable to recognize the new realities in the SouthCaucasus," the statement reads.

As for the claims in the resolution, the Milli Majlis noted thatAzerbaijan is always committed to the position of protecting humanrights and fundamental freedoms, ensuring the rule of law, andconsistent implementation of the principles of the rule of law.

"The use of double standards in assessing the situationregarding human rights, freedom of assembly, speech, andinformation in Azerbaijan is unacceptable. It's regrettable thatthe European Parliament, which readily criticizes Azerbaijan onhuman rights issues, remains silent about the plight of over onemillion Azerbaijani refugees and internally displaced persons(IDPs). These individuals have endured expulsion from theirhomeland, ethnic cleansing, and genocide during the occupation ofAzerbaijani territories by Armenia," the statement said.

The statement emphasizes that such activities against Azerbaijanjeopardize bilateral relations and damage the European Parliament'scredibility. The Milli Majlis asks the European Parliament to avoidacts that undermine our country's democratic development efforts,to take an objective stance on Azerbaijan-related issues, and toavoid one-sided approaches motivated by political interests.

The Azerbaijani Parliament emphasized that no force couldpersuade Azerbaijan to abandon the path of democraticdevelopment.
